No one is saying not to patronize her, in fact, I've asked her for products personally when my customers ask for something below the grade and budget of what I sell...

People are talking about leaving out details supposed to be provided to a buyer, using the word original for a fake/clone/imitation.

Whether or not the customer knows the cost of original, a buyer isn't supposed to use the word original to advertise, even if, he/she should state out clearly they're not original from Nike stores, and give a detailed info, the country of manufacture, if the customer asks... She may lose that sales, but it will prevent bad reputation and issues like this.
Bad review spreads faster and blocks tens of sales compared to good review.

Airline crew will still state out safety procedures, whether or not the customers knew already or not, because it's their duty.

Let's not turn this insincere assessment of a situation or case into a norm because the accused is our person or close to us.

I will post this here again, ye who has eyes, let them read.

GUIDES TO AVOID BEEN SCAMMED

AS A BUYER
* Do a check on the account or the person selling, a search of the moniker or contact number should bring out any related posts about them.
* Don't be in a rush to pay for an instate item to someone you did not know, no matter how sweet the price is.
* A seller that has bad or nasty attitude/manners during enquiries should be a red flag to you.
* Don't send money ahead for items to be waybilled, to be on a safer side, look for someone you know in the seller's town to meet and transact then send to you.
* If not on clearance thread and the price is too good to be true, do your survey about the item cost, ask the seller questions, they should satisfy reasonable curiousity about what they are selling, otherwise, give it up.
* Don't be moved by the term "other people are on it", and be convinced to pay if you are not sure of the seller.
* Beware of payment before delivery sellers, if they dont want to risk been scammed, they should provide a pick up or meeting location.
Opt for Escrow services as a safer resort.


AS A SELLER
* If you cannot run payment on delivery, at least give a payment on pick up option at your location or within.
* If it is to be waybilled, ask them to get someone themselve that can come and get the item and waybill to them if you don't want to do that. (I have sent goods to friends out of lagos many times, to meet up with the buyer, have my payment transfered and release item to the seller, it's a risk of wasting waybil fund, but i can work around that, but I will never force someone skeptical, after giving my registeration number, my personal and business online accounts of years, to make payment before waybil, I understand the fear of being duped)
* Don't respond to sellers as if you are dashing them the item for sale, even if you are dashing them, it takes nothing to be nice.
* To further assure buyer you are legit (this method has never failed in convincing a buyer I am legit)
- tell them they could call you on video call to confirm your identity.
- provide a social media account if old and active that has your face all over it.
- Assure them you would send your ID(cover your id number) with same name as account number they are to pay to. ( this confirms they are paying to your account that can be traced to you and not a PAGA account that you will withdraw and be untraceable after scamming them)
* If a buyer has questions, try and respond to them, if you are finding it uncomfortable, simply say it has been sold, bad attitude as a seller is not ideal.
* Do not hold your items for promises if you do not want to, this will eradicate having to ask someone to pay as many people are on it, who pays first or comes to inspect and pay gets the item.
